Apple and Google have each rolled out a new premium device—Apple’s iPhone 18 Pro and Google’s Pixel 11 Pro—setting up a direct contest for brand‑loyal consumers and market dominance. Early reviews suggest the outcome could affect quarterly earnings for both firms.
The Pixel 11 Pro’s customizable pocket‑camera system and its foldable variant draw particular attention. The absence of these data points means the true impact on buyer decisions and future market share remains unclear.
